Output 186689f718d633ceda71ef1ee2390ece89e65b35a816d5bd18291b6e5cf1ed46:0

value
34488369
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e81e6f542835a47e709ed7e59bfb57ede3c8d1cf OP_EQUALVERIFY OP_CHECKSIG
address
1NALEA7JPoP26Sy9hjYaCFuzHjgYNgzUsQ
transaction
186689f718d633ceda71ef1ee2390ece89e65b35a816d5bd18291b6e5cf1ed46
spent
true